## Step 4: Load test the checkout flow

Before we flip traffic to the new Cartwheel checkout service, run the load harness against the perf environment — not staging, which shares a payment stub with QA. From a security angle, note that the harness uses synthetic card tokens only. Target 500 RPS for ten minutes and watch error rates. The harness expects these settings.

settings of tagef-bawif:
DRUIX_HOST=druix.zemvarlabs.internal
DRUIX_PORT=8000

Subject: Maintainer change for SpokeShift

Dear plugin authors, after three years stewarding the SpokeShift rebalancing tool and its extension API, I am moving to the Harbonne depot-forecasting team. Plugin review timelines and the compatibility policy remain unchanged; the deprecation calendar will be honored as published. Effective next Monday, all plugin matters should be directed to the new maintainer, named below.

account owner for tawef-yadug: Jorius Normir Silath

## Deploying quota-guard

Welcome aboard! quota-guard is the little service that enforces per-tenant rate quotas in front of the Brightmere API. Deploys are boring on purpose: push a tag, the Ferrow pipeline builds it, and it rolls out region by region. Two things to know — quotas are hot-reloaded, so you rarely need a restart, and the burst multiplier is per-tenant, not global, which trips up everyone at least once. Each environment starts the service with the following configuration values.

settings of yageg-yahap:
[gorael]
team = olieth
access_code = ac_941d74
owner = brieth.aldiel
host = gorael.tolvaqio.internal
port = 6379
peer = briwyn.urlaqtech.internal
salt = 116e6622
pin = 1957

**FAQ: How do I unlock the Ledgerlight audit-log viewer after a failed release rollback?**

When a rollback aborts mid-write, Ledgerlight seals its index to protect audit integrity and the viewer shows a lock banner. As release manager, you can unseal it yourself rather than filing a ticket. Open Admin → Integrity → Unseal, then enter the recovery passphrase provided below.

unlock words, hahip-baduf: holwyn-istath-julvan